Louder Than A Bomb is the largest teen poetry festival in the world. Aiming to bring teens together across racial, gang, and socio-economic lines, Louder Than A Bomb provides friendly competition that emphasizes self-expression and community through poetry, oral storytelling, and hip-hop spoken word. The festival is an Olympic-style poetry competition, featuring 70 teams and 650 students in 2011. During the festival, there are also plenty of noncompetitive events such as Buddy Wakefield’s performance. Two-time individual world poetry slam champion, he is performing an extended feature set as part of Columbia College Chicago’s Silver Tongue Reading Series, cosponsored by Verbatim. Just another reminder that at Louder Than A Bomb, the points are not the point.

This performance contains explicit language.

Recorded Monday, February 28, 2011 at Columbia College Chicago.
